[ACCESS RESTRICTED TO THE UNIVERSITY OF MISSOURI AT AUTHOR'S REQUEST.] Previous research has established that virtual reality (VR) technology provides users a unique user-system interaction. However, little research has been conducted to understand how VR technology contributes to system usability within specific contexts. The current research investigates how users perceive desktop VR differently from conventional 2D graphics and how system usability is affected by the user-system interaction process within a VR system. The impact of desktop VR on system usability was empirically examined from an integrated view of technology acceptance in information systems and human-computer interaction. This research tested a model of the user-system interaction process (perceived ease of use, perceived usefulness, and presence) and outcomes measured by system usability dimensions (satisfaction and decision confidence) for a VR system. Data were collected to compare the process and outcomes of using a VR system and a conventional 2D system to engage in a consumer survey. In addition, how user characteristics affect user-system interaction while using a VR system was examined. The results largely support the proposition that VR technology provides system usability with significantly higher perceived usefulness and presence than do the conventional 2D formats. The current work provides new knowledge about usability, sense of presence and technology acceptance in desktop VR and provides insights for future research with and predicted applications of desktop VR.

The factors of context-awareness and mobile ubiquity are major components in the development and diffusion of any mobile technology-driven applications and services. Principally in the m-government development space, the issues of context-awareness and ubiquity are crucial if m-government initiatives are to be successful. The moderating effect of context-awareness and ubiquity on mobile government adoption is examined for 409 students from a Chinese University based on the Technology Acceptance Model. Using the Structural Equation Modeling technique, the results indicate that perceived ease of use (PEOU) was significantly related to intention to use, but perceived usefulness (PU) did not have a significant effect on mobile government adoption. The moderating analysis indicated that context-awareness significantly moderated the impact of PU but had no moderating effect on PEOU. Also, it was discovered that ubiquity was significant in moderating both the PEOU and PU on mobile government adoption. Policy implications and directions for future research are presented.

The application of augmented reality in tourism is flourishing and promising, bringing an emerging body of studies. While virtual reality might be a virtual threat to the travel and tourism as being a potential substitute, augmented reality allows users to interact with the real environment that could potentially enhance visitors’ experience. Distinguishing from reviews that combine studies of augmented reality and virtual reality, this study systematically investigates the current state of augmented reality research exclusively in the tourism literature. The results identify five established and emerging research clusters, with one predominant cluster that focuses on user acceptance of augmented reality, commonly applying the technology acceptance model. A meta-analysis of a subset of four empirical studies reveals that perceived ease of use has an overall influence of 52.79% on perceived usefulness. Lastly, a concept map visually presents the constructs that have been explored across the clusters. Based on our review, future research directions are proposed to advance knowledge in the emerging area of gamification, to explore the potential negative consequences of augmented reality, and to apply more innovative methods and study designs.

Virtual reality presents exciting new opportunities for e-commerce with regard to the development of innovative shopping services. This article reports on an experimental investigation into the coordinated use of two human-computer interfaces (HCIs) for online shopping: virtual reality (VR) and webpages. We adopted the uses and gratification theory and technology acceptance model to determine how these HCIs affect online shopping intentions. Data from 98 participants revealed that entertainment value, informativeness, perceived ease-of-use, and perceived usefulness are the primary factors influencing the intention to use the VR HCI for online shopping (p < 0.05). Informativeness, perceived ease-of-use, and perceived usefulness are the main factors influencing the intention to use the webpage HCI for online shopping (p < 0.05). This study provides insights for businesses how to develop innovative shopping services using VR.

<p>Mobile payment has relative advantages compared to other payment methods, thus providing benefits for both consumers and the society. This study attempts to examine factors influencing consumer intention to use mobile payment services. Survey data are used to investigate the impact of consumers’ perceptions of mobile payment services and social influence on use intention. Empirical evidence from 489 Vietnamese consumers confirms a significant relationship between the factors and behavioral intention, and reveals that perceived trust is the strongest predictor of intention to use mobile payment services followed by perceived ease of use, perceived enjoyment, perceived behavioral control, perceived usefulness and subjective norm, respectively. The results contribute to the evolving literature, and suggest that mobile payment service providers should particularly focus on building up consumer trust, and making their services clear, understandable and easy to use. Future research directions for extending this study are also discussed.</p>

This research extended the Technology Acceptance Model (TAM) with perceived trust and perceived risks (security and privacy concerns) constructs to identify the impact of these factors on Jordanian users’ intentions to adopt mobile commerce (m-commerce). An empirical test was used utilizing 132 responses from students in two public universities in Jordan. Results indicated that perceived trust, perceived usefulness, and perceived ease of use are major influencers of mobile commerce adoption. On the other hand, perceived risk factors (security and privacy concerns) were not significant in this relation. Discussion, conclusion and future work are stated at the end of this paper.

The purpose of the study is to examine the factors that impact the intention of Saudi citizens to use a mobile government smartphone application (Absher). Saudi Arabia seeks to invest and develop the infrastructure of the government’s mobile services, to be one of the leading countries in the region. Smartphone applications backed by mobile technologies have changed mobile services use which permit anywhere at any time access. Drawing on technology acceptance theories and relevant literature, this study developed and tested a structural model that integrates factors perceived usefulness, perceived ease of use, perceived privacy and trust in order to investigate the predictors of Absher use intention in the Saudi Arabia. The proposed model is tested using structural equation model (SEM) on data collected using an online questionnaire. Statistical analysis revealed that intention to use Absher was significantly associated with perceived trust, security and privacy, ease of use, and usefulness. Drawing on the technology acceptance model and trust theory, this study develops and empirically examines a model for users' intention to use mobile government services. This study contributes to the marketing literature by examining the impact of PU, PEOU and trust on mobile government services acceptance in developing countries.

PurposeThis paper aims to examine the current technology acceptance model (TAM) in the field of mixed reality and digital twin (MRDT) and identify key factors affecting users' intentions to use MRDT. The factors are used as a set of key metrics for proposing a predictive model for virtual, augmented and mixed reality (MR) acceptance by users. This model is called the extended TAM for MRDT adoption in the architecture, engineering, construction and operations (AECO) industry.Design/methodology/approachAn interpretivist philosophical lens was adopted to conduct an inductive systematic and bibliographical analysis of secondary data contained within published journal articles that focused upon MRDT acceptance modelling. The preferred reporting items for systematic reviews and meta-analyses (PRISMA) approach to meta-analysis were adopted to ensure all key investigations were included in the final database set. Quantity indicators such as path coefficients, factor ranking, Cronbach’s alpha (a) and chi-square (b) test, coupled with content analysis, were used for examining the database constructed. The database included journal papers from 2010 to 2020.FindingsThe extant literature revealed that the most commonly used constructs of the MRDT–TAM included: subjective norm; social influence; perceived ease of use (PEOU); perceived security; perceived enjoyment; satisfaction; perceived usefulness (PU); attitude; and behavioural intention (BI). Using these identified constructs, the general extended TAM for MRDT in the AECO industry is developed. Other important factors such as “perceived immersion” could be added to the obtained model.Research limitations/implicationsThe decision to utilise a new technology is difficult and high risk in the construction project context, due to the complexity of MRDT technologies and dynamic construction environment. The outcome of the decision may affect employee performance, project productivity and on-site safety. The extended acceptance model offers a set of factors that assist managers or practitioners in making effective decisions for utilising any type of MRDT technology.Practical implicationsSeveral constraints are apparent due to the limited investigation of MRDT evaluation matrices and empirical studies. For example, the research only covers technologies which have been reported in the literature, relating to virtual reality (VR), augmented reality (AR), MR, DT and sensors, so newer technologies may not be included. Moreover, the review process could span a longer time period and thus embrace a fuller spectrum of technology development in these different areas.Originality/valueThe research provides a theoretical model for measuring and evaluating MRDT acceptance at the individual level in the AECO context and signposts future research related to MRDT adoption in the AECO industry, as well as providing managerial guidance for progressive AECO professionals who seek to expand their use of MRDT in the Fourth Industrial Revolution (4IR). A set of key factors affecting MRDT acceptance is identified which will help innovators to improve their technology to achieve a wider acceptance.

Short Messaging Service (SMS) being an almost instantaneous communication medium that connects people is now a phenomenon that has grown and spread around the globe at an amazing speed. Given the current trend of SMS usage and its potential growth, this paper provides an insight into SMS adoption. The study attempts to delineate the demographics and usage profile of SMS users in Malaysia, as well as explaining the factors influencing SMS adoption in Malaysia by using a modified version of the Technology Acceptance Model (TAM), which was originally introduced by Davis (1989). The study presents the demographic and usage profile in terms of gender, age, occupation, monthly personal income, extent of SMS usage and so forth of 489 SMS users from four institutions of education in the Klang Valley and Selangor. The present research uses and validates the scales for variables developed by earlier studies, namely perceived usefulness, perceived ease of use, perceived enjoyment, and perceived fees, which are hypothesized to be fundamental determinants of behavioural intention. The scale items for the said variables were tested for reliability, correlation and regression. The application of correlation analysis reveals a significant relationship among the independent variables, namely, perceived usefulness, perceived enjoyment, and perceived ease of use with the dependent variable that is behavioural intention. With regards to the level of importance derived from regression analysis, usefulness ranks the highest, followed by ease of use and enjoyment in explaining SMS adoption in Malaysia. Perceived fees do not seem to have a significant relationship with behavioural intention. Some implications, limitations and recommendations for future research are also discussed.

Purpose The purpose of this paper is to review existing literature on users’ digital learning acceptance behavior and to identify gaps in the current body of knowledge and suggest future research directions. The paper also includes identification of motivating as well as inhibiting factors previously explored by academicians in the acceptance of digital learning. Design/methodology/approach The systematic literature review based on PRISMA methodology was conducted, and 200 articles from peer-reviewed journals on digital learning acceptance behavior using technology adoption theories were examined. Findings The study found an overall rise in the number of papers published yearly during 2002–2017. Most of the studies were published in two journals, i.e. Computers & Education and Computers in Human Behaviour and were carried out in Asia followed by Europe, North America, Africa, Oceania and South America. It was also noted that most of the studies have used the technology acceptance model and were empirical in nature. The study also found that prominently students’ digital learning acceptance behavior was investigated. The review also indicates a lack of qualitative and mixed method (qualitative and quantitative) approaches to study digital learning acceptance behavior. Practical implications The study identified gaps in the current body of knowledge by reviewing published articles that will suggest future directions for further research. The top three determinants of digital learning acceptance that have been analyzed were the behavioral intention, perceived usefulness and perceived ease of use, followed by attitude and user behavior. The study articulates the implications for providers in marketing digital learning products, for higher education institution in expanding digital content, for students seeking digital education tools, for educators in motivating students to accept digital learning and for governments in delivering cost-effective public education by utilizing digital learning. Originality/value The paper analyzes 200 publications on digital learning acceptance through technology adoption theories. To the best of the authors’ knowledge, this is the first initiative to provide systematic and exhaustive summarization of the knowledge in this subject. It further explores the various factors influencing digital learning adoption behavior and provides avenues for future research. The paper is useful for researchers working on digital learning acceptance behavior.
